package org.apache.storm.streams.processors;
import java.util.HashMap;
import java.util.Map;
import org.apache.storm.streams.Pair;
import org.apache.storm.streams.operations.Reducer;
public class ReduceByKeyProcessor<K, V> extends BaseProcessor<Pair<K, V>> implements BatchProcessor {
private final Reducer<V> reducer;
private final Map<K, V> state = new HashMap<>();
public ReduceByKeyProcessor(Reducer<V> reducer) {
this.reducer = reducer;
}
@Override
public void execute(Pair<K, V> input) {
K key = input.getFirst();
V val = input.getSecond();
V agg = state.get(key);
final V res = (agg == null) ? val : reducer.apply(agg, val);
state.put(key, res);
mayBeForwardAggUpdate(() -> Pair.of(key, res));
}
@Override
public void finish() {
for (Map.Entry<K, V> entry : state.entrySet()) {
context.forward(Pair.of(entry.getKey(), entry.getValue()));
}
state.clear();
}
}
